The Los Angeles Lakers made one of the biggest moves in NBA history on Sunday by landing LeBron James in free agency. And then they proceeded to baffle the NBA world with some head-scratching moves over the next 24 hours. After signing Kentavious Caldwell-Pope to a one-year, $12 million deal (a sensible move), the Lakers continued by signing Lance Stephenson, one of James' biggest rivals, to a one-year, $4.5 million contract. They then added center JaVale McGee to a one-year, minimum deal. On Monday, the Lakers renounced their rights to free agent big man Julius Randle, a young, talented player with big potential, to sign 32-year-old point guard Rajon Rondo to a one-year, $9 million deal.
